J15S flipped a somersault horizontally in the air. Zhang Peng in the front seat was just about to wake up when the immense centrifugal force knocked him unconscious again. Liu Jun, meanwhile, was completely focused on the triangular aircraft ahead and didn't notice his instructor's condition.

The tenacious enemy behind them pointed its nose degree by degree toward them. The triangular aircraft, lacking speed in the air, seemed to sense its doom approaching, twisting desperately in an attempt to break free from the opponent's attack envelope, or perhaps trying to confuse them.

But reality was reality—without speed, an aircraft has nothing.

Liu Jun attacked the triangular aircraft hanging in the sky like shooting at a fixed target, easily seeing through its camouflage and precisely hitting its true position.

The glass-like fuselage couldn't withstand the 30mm cannon fire. The entire triangular aircraft was shredded, countless fragments falling downward, reflecting iridescent light in their descent like rainbows falling from the sky.

Having shot down his target, Liu Jun didn't dare relax at all, because another triangular aircraft was still engaging his comrade.

PL10 hadn't shot down the triangular aircraft as expected. Two J15S had already entered a dogfight with it. Fortunately, it was a two-ship formation—during the battle, the lead aircraft was responsible for attacking while the wingman provided cover.

In a two-versus-one situation, they weren't at a disadvantage, but they also couldn't do anything to this aircraft. Both sides were locked in a stalemate.

After expending its missiles, the lead J15S locked onto the triangular aircraft's six o'clock position. The HUD displayed the firing solution. The pilot adjusted the nose position and opened fire.

The GSH-30-1 cannon spat out a stream of tracers. The 150-round ammunition count dropped by a third in an instant.

"What's going on, Old Gun!"

His cannon fire had been ineffective. The front-seat pilot clearly saw the tracer rounds hit where the triangular aircraft was, but it acted as if nothing had happened.

"Cannon ineffective?"

"Impossible! Fatty shot one down over there!"

If the cannon were useless, Fatty (Zhang Peng) wouldn't have used it to down an enemy aircraft.

"Try again! Maybe we didn't hit a critical damage point!"

"Copy!"

After a series of attacks failed to hit the target, the triangular aircraft pulled up sharply, trying to climb. The J15S followed closely. The enemy twisted and rolled in the air, attempting to enter a rolling scissors maneuver with the pursuing aircraft, but the J15S wasn't fighting alone. It immediately pulled up and decelerated to avoid overshooting.

At that moment, the wingman surged in from the triangular aircraft's absolutely disadvantaged rear hemisphere, firing another burst of cannon rounds at the enemy. This time, the lead aircraft's pilot clearly saw the cannon rounds pass straight through the triangular aircraft.

After the cannon fire, the wingman pulled up to prepare for another attack.

"Something's wrong. I saw the rounds go right through!"

"Me too!"

If the previous attacks were because they missed the target, this close-range shot was clearly witnessed by both pilots in the lead aircraft.

"Try again!"

The two J15S refused to accept it. They took turns attacking the triangular aircraft. The 30mm cannon ammunition dropped rapidly, but the enemy still wasn't shot down. Every attack passed straight through its fuselage.

"Something's wrong! This is an illusion!" the lead aircraft's pilot, Old Gun, said over the internal comms.

The triangular aircraft they saw was just a projected illusion. How it deceived the avionics system, they didn't know. They only knew the target was fake!

"Where's the real one?!"

"No idea!"

The pilots scanned the surroundings with their naked eyes but found nothing unusual.

"How did Fatty find the real one?"

Old Gun muttered to himself, never imagining that Fatty had so many tricks up his sleeve. But the comm channel was jammed now, so they couldn't communicate with him.

"Conserve ammo. We don't have much left, and they're in the same boat!"

The tricky part now was that even knowing the triangular aircraft in front of them was a manufactured illusion—like a towed decoy on modern fighters, only more advanced—they still had to figure out how to find its real body.

"Switch to IRST!"

"Copy!"

This was where the advantage of a two-seater showed. Old Gun in the front seat controlled the fighter to continue tailing, while the weapon officer in the rear began scanning with IRST, trying to find the real body's heat source. On a single-seat fighter, the pilot handling both tasks would quickly drain their energy, leading to degraded performance or mistakes!

"No good. IRST can't find any other heat source!"

Within the IRST's field of view, only the triangular aircraft's heat signature was captured. There was no second heat source. And since they'd already confirmed the aircraft in front was an illusion, how was it fooling the IRST? As for radar, it had completely failed once they got close.

But these weren't their concerns. They only had one thing to do: find the real body and shoot it down!

Thump! Thump! Thump!

The cannon fired a burst to the left of the triangular aircraft—the same position where Fatty had shot down the first one. But the attack hit nothing, and their ammunition was running low.

"Where the hell is the real one?!"

Just as Old Gun was getting frustrated, a low-visibility J15S suddenly appeared in his field of view, diving from high altitude straight toward the triangular aircraft ahead.

"Did Fatty take down the second one?"

Was Fatty on fire today? How was he this good?!

In Old Gun's astonished gaze, the diving [139] aircraft pointed its nose slightly above the triangular aircraft and opened fire!

The cannon rounds hit the air as if striking something solid. Fragmentation shells exploded, and then the shattered triangular aircraft appeared at the point of impact. Half its fuselage was destroyed, spinning as it fell toward the sea below.

With a roar, [139] aircraft passed through their position and dove downward. During the dive, Liu Jun throttled back and deployed the airbrakes. Once his speed dropped enough, he retracted the airbrakes and used the momentum from the dive to climb back up into the sky.

[Insufficient fuel.]

[Insufficient fuel.]

[Insufficient fuel.]

The AI Sister's alert tone chimed in his ear. Liu Jun glanced at the fuel gauge—it had already entered the warning line. Barring any surprises, he wouldn't make it back flying.

A rustling static came through his earpiece. With the three delta-wing aircraft shot down, the chaotic electromagnetic interference had faded, but some residual electromagnetic noise remained, distorting the communication slightly.

Just then, Zhang Peng, sitting in the front seat, jolted awake. His memory was still stuck in the previous battle. He was about to pull the stick for a maneuver when he realized the enemies were gone. At that moment, Liu Jun's voice rang in his ear:

"Master, you're awake? The fight's over."
